告别提瓦特重复劳作:BetterGenshinImpact如何重新定义原神自动化体验
BetterGenshinImpact(简称BGI)是一款开源的原神自动化工具,通过AI图像识别技术模拟人类视觉与操作逻辑,实现钓鱼、采集、战斗等任务的智能化执行。它能像游戏玩家一样"看懂"画面元素,自主决策并完成操作,让玩家从机械重复的任务中解放,专注于探索提瓦特大陆的核心乐趣。
用户场景:你是否也面临这些提瓦特生存难题?
当你第5次手动收集琉璃百合时,是否想过为什么不能让角色自己规划路线?当钓鱼 mini-game 第12次断线时,是否怀疑这才是原神真正的"体力系统"?当树脂快要溢出却没时间刷圣遗物时,是否觉得游戏正在吞噬你的碎片时间?这些重复、机械、低价值的操作,正是BGI要解决的核心问题。
场景一:时间碎片化困境
学生党和上班族常因"上线10分钟,任务1小时"的时间成本望而却步,每日委托、体力消耗等固定流程成为负担。
场景二:操作精度挑战
钓鱼时的力度控制、采集时的精准点击、战斗时的技能衔接,对操作精度要求高,长时间重复易导致疲劳失误。
场景三:资源管理压力
圣遗物强化、角色突破材料收集等资源管理工作繁琐,需要频繁切换地图和角色,效率低下。
功能矩阵:四大核心能力重构游戏体验
🛠️ 智能视觉识别系统
通过OpenCV图像比对与OCR文字识别技术(核心实现位于Core/Recognition/OpenCv/),BGI能精准定位游戏界面元素。就像给程序装上"眼睛",它能识别鱼漂状态、资源图标、NPC对话框等关键信息,识别准确率达92%以上。
⚙️ 多任务自动化引擎
采用行为树(BT)架构设计的任务系统(GameTask/Common/StateMachine/),支持并行执行多个自动化任务。例如在采集木材的同时自动战斗,或在钓鱼时同步监控体力状态,就像有多个"分身"同时处理不同事务。
📊 自适应决策算法
不同于固定脚本的机械执行,BGI内置环境感知模块(Core/BgiVision/BvPage.cs),能根据游戏内实时变化调整策略。比如钓鱼时会根据鱼的拉力动态调整收线力度,战斗时会根据敌人类型切换技能组合。
🎮 低侵入式操作模拟
通过Windows Input API模拟物理输入(Fischless.WindowsInput/),避免直接内存读写,操作方式与人工操作一致。就像有个虚拟手柄在帮你按键,既保证安全性又不破坏游戏平衡。

图中展示了BGI支持的多种自动化场景,包括角色协同、资源采集和战斗辅助等核心功能
实施路径:从安装到运行的三步避坑指南
第一步:环境准备与权限配置
克隆项目仓库后,需安装.NET 6.0运行时和Visual Studio 2022。⚠️ 关键注意事项:必须以管理员身份运行程序,否则会导致屏幕捕获失败;需在系统设置中开启"屏幕录制"权限,Windows用户可通过"设置-隐私和安全性-屏幕录制"路径开启。
第二步:游戏参数校准
首次启动时通过[Core/Config/GenshinStartConfig.cs]配置游戏路径,建议使用"自动检测"功能。⚠️ 避坑要点:确保游戏分辨率与工具配置一致(默认1920×1080),分辨率不匹配会导致识别偏差;关闭游戏内"动态模糊"和"抗锯齿"功能,提高图像识别稳定性。
第三步:任务模块启用
在主界面"任务中心"勾选所需功能,钓鱼模块需额外配置[GameTask/AutoFishing/AutoFishingConfig.cs]中的咬钩阈值(建议新手设置为0.75)。⚠️ 安全提示:先在璃月港等安全区域测试功能,避免在战斗场景中直接启用导致意外死亡。
进阶策略:三个高效工作流模板
模板一:每日清体力组合
适用场景:每天30分钟快速处理体力
任务组合:自动周本 → 圣遗物副本 → 体力消耗提醒
配置路径:在[GameTask/AutoDomain/AutoDomainConfig.cs]中设置优先副本列表,启用"自动切换角色"选项,系统会按效率排序自动完成8次副本挑战。
模板二:资源采集路线
适用场景:周末集中收集材料
任务组合:木材采集 → 矿石挖掘 → 特产收集
配置路径:在[GameTask/AutoPathing/Model/PathPoint.cs]中导入社区共享的采集路线文件,设置"优先采集稀有度"参数,工具会自动规划最优采集顺序。
模板三:钓鱼休闲模式
适用场景:边看剧边钓鱼
任务组合:自动抛竿 → 智能收线 → 背包整理
配置路径:在[GameTask/AutoFishing/AutoFishingConfig.cs]中启用"只钓稀有鱼"选项,设置"最大等待时间"为30秒,系统会自动筛选高价值鱼类并整理背包。
工具使用边界:合理应用的三个原则
BGI的设计初衷是减轻重复劳动,而非替代游戏体验。建议遵循以下使用原则:
- 适度使用:自动化任务时长控制在每日1小时内,避免过度依赖导致游戏乐趣丧失
- 场景限制:不用于PVP或联机场景,仅在单人模式下使用
- 版本同步:每次游戏更新后等待工具适配,避免因版本差异导致功能异常
通过合理配置和使用,BetterGenshinImpact能成为提瓦特冒险的得力助手,让你有更多时间探索剧情、欣赏风景、与朋友互动。记住,自动化工具的终极目标是让游戏回归乐趣本质,而非变成另一个需要管理的"任务清单"。
官方文档:[Docs/readme_en.md]
配置文件目录:[BetterGenshinImpact/Core/Config/]
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0242-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
electerm开源终端/ssh/telnet/serialport/RDP/VNC/Spice/sftp/ftp客户端(linux, mac, win)JavaScript00